Leonardo Franco + Caterina Badalucco

No children
16021631
Birth: 10 December 1602Erice, Trapani, Sicilia, Italy
Death: after 30 December 1631
15981631
Birth: 20 October 1598 32 26 Erice, Trapani, Sicilia, Italy
Death: after 30 December 1631
15661635
Birth: about 1566 36 31 Erice, Trapani, Sicilia, Italy
Death: 29 April 1635Erice, Trapani, Sicilia, Italy
15721635
Birth: about 1572 42 42 Erice, Trapani, Sicilia, Italy
Death: after 3 November 1635

Facts and events

Marriage